Form 4: Director Shulman Boosts Stake in Wrap Technologies

Sentiment:

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ership


John D. Shulman, a director of Wrap Technologies, Inc., acquired 250,000 shares of common stock and 250,000 warrants in a private placement.

Capital raiseThe filing details a private placement where Wrap Technologies, Inc. sold 250,000 shares of common stock at $2.00 per share and 250,000 warrants with an exercise price of $2.30 to Director John D. Shulman, indicating a capital raise for the company.

Summary

  • John D. Shulman, a director of Wrap Technologies, Inc. (WRAP), acquired 250,000 shares of common stock at $2.00 per share.
  • Shulman also acquired 250,000 warrants with an exercise price of $2.30 per share.
  • These acquisitions were made through a private placement pursuant to a Securities Purchase Agreement dated February 2, 2026.
  • The securities are indirectly owned by Juggernaut Management, LLC, where John D. Shulman serves as Manager, and he disclaims beneficial ownership except to the extent of his pecuniary interest.
